Doomster Posted July 31, 2006 Share Posted July 31, 2006 Don't go large on hitpoint-free training (curses, alchs etc.) unless you want to hybrid and gain hitpoints another way. If not yet through tutorial, drop the runes you are given, and get more, collect about 6 lots, that should get you to level 3 out of tutorial. Actually, I'd also raise strength to 3 in the rat cage, and attack to 8 on the dummies (hitpointless) so that a steel pick can be wielded for mining and no less pure once mage leads. The mage quests are crucial (Witch's potion & Imp catcher), as is Doric's (buy/pick up the 2 Iron and you can then move up to a steel pick), cooks assistant and of course, Rune Mysteries. The Imps for Imp catcher are the best chance of a mind talisman, then RC airs and minds and use then to strike from safety. In F2p, there is no mage kit with defence requirements, so defence is useless for the mage. In members, you may prefer to be a mystic mage (20 def), though that means using expensive kit. There are some other items that can be used in a 1-defence kit for members, such as a Zamorak robe bottom, or Ghostly robes (though it seems impossible to get them without getting prayer).
